A Home Away from Home

Last night Benedict was at the Takeaway/Restaurant waiting for workers from ZESCO (the power company) to come to fix a big problem. He started talking to one of the big truck drivers who was from Botswana. The man said that a few nights before he had planned to stop for the night at our place, but there were so many trucks, he didn’t think there would be room, so he kept going on.

The first praise is that we have so many trucks coming to park for the night!

He went on to say that he had emptied his load, and on the way back, he knew that he had to stop at the Hope Takeaway. He said that this is like his home!

The second praise is that because of the atmosphere, and the warm welcome many truck drivers feel that this is a safe and good place to stop!

Isn’t it amazing how God works? If we had opened a restaurant for just people traveling on the road, or people in the community, we would not have been successful. But God led us to make a truck stop that was clean, safe, and free of many of the temptations that truckers face on their long trips. Only God knew that that was what we needed and what these drivers needed.
